Importance of Fleet Maintenance
Regular fleet maintenance is crucial for companies looking to save thousands of dollars annually. By keeping vehicles in top condition, businesses can avoid unexpected breakdowns, reduce repair costs, and improve overall efficiency.
Cost Savings from Well-Maintained Fleets
- Reduced repair expenses: Well-maintained fleets experience fewer mechanical issues, leading to lower repair costs over time.
- Extended vehicle lifespan: Regular maintenance helps prolong the life of vehicles, delaying the need for expensive replacements.
- Improved fuel efficiency: Properly maintained vehicles tend to be more fuel-efficient, saving companies money on fuel expenses.
- Enhanced safety: Maintained fleets are less likely to experience accidents due to mechanical failures, reducing potential liability costs.
Preventive Maintenance for Cost Prevention
- Regular inspections and tune-ups can identify potential issues before they escalate into major problems, saving companies from costly repairs.
- Following manufacturer-recommended maintenance schedules can help prevent breakdowns and ensure optimal performance of vehicles.
- Addressing minor issues promptly through preventive maintenance can prevent them from developing into more severe and expensive problems in the future.
Key Areas of Fleet Maintenance
Effective fleet maintenance involves several key areas that are crucial for ensuring the longevity and efficiency of a company's vehicles.
Essential Components of Fleet Maintenance
- Regular oil changes and fluid checks to keep the engine running smoothly.
- Tire rotations and replacements to maintain optimal traction and safety on the road.
- Brake inspections and repairs to ensure reliable stopping power.
- Battery checks and replacements to prevent unexpected breakdowns.
Role of Scheduled Inspections
Scheduled inspections play a vital role in maintaining fleet health by identifying potential issues before they escalate into costly repairs or breakdowns.
- Regular inspections help detect wear and tear on essential components early on.
- Preventive maintenance based on inspection findings can extend the lifespan of fleet vehicles.
Monitoring Fuel Efficiency
Monitoring fuel efficiency is a critical aspect of fleet maintenance that directly impacts operating costs and overall productivity.
- Tracking fuel consumption helps identify inefficiencies and optimize routes for cost savings.
- Regular maintenance, such as tuning the engine and checking tire pressure, can improve fuel efficiency.
- Implementing fuel-efficient driving practices among drivers can further reduce fuel consumption.
Cost-Effective Maintenance Strategies
Implementing cost-effective maintenance strategies is crucial for companies looking to save money and maximize the lifespan of their fleet vehicles.
Outsourcing Maintenance Tasks
Outsourcing maintenance tasks to specialized service providers can be a cost-effective strategy for fleet maintenance. By leveraging the expertise of professionals, companies can ensure that their vehicles are properly maintained without the need to invest in specialized equipment or hire additional staff.
This can lead to significant cost savings in the long run, as outsourcing allows for efficient and timely maintenance, reducing the risk of costly breakdowns and repairs.
Predictive Maintenance
Predictive maintenance involves using data and analytics to predict when maintenance is needed on a vehicle before a breakdown occurs. By monitoring key performance indicators and using predictive maintenance software, companies can identify potential issues early on and address them proactively.
This can help prevent unexpected downtime, reduce repair costs, and extend the lifespan of fleet vehicles, ultimately saving companies thousands of dollars annually.
Data-Driven Maintenance Approaches
Data-driven maintenance approaches utilize data analytics to optimize fleet maintenance processes, leading to improved efficiency and cost savings. By leveraging data, companies can make informed decisions regarding maintenance schedules, repairs, and part replacements.
Role of Telematics in Tracking Vehicle Performance
Telematics technology plays a crucial role in tracking vehicle performance by collecting real-time data on factors such as engine health, fuel consumption, and driver behavior. This data allows fleet managers to monitor the condition of vehicles remotely and identify potential issues before they escalate.
By analyzing telematics data, companies can implement preventive maintenance measures, reducing downtime and costly repairs.
Examples of Data-Driven Decisions for Cost Savings
- Utilizing predictive maintenance algorithms based on historical data to schedule maintenance tasks proactively, avoiding unexpected breakdowns and costly repairs.
- Analyzing fuel consumption data to optimize routes and driving patterns, leading to reduced fuel expenses and lower carbon emissions.
- Implementing predictive analytics to forecast part failures and stock up on necessary components in advance, minimizing downtime and improving operational efficiency.
